Eight Sleep Partners with Aston Martin Aramco Team

Eight Sleep is a sleep technology company, renowned for its Pod system, which combines dynamic temperature regulation, biometric tracking, and artificial intelligence-powered insights. A noteworthy feature of this technology is that the system can learn and adapt night by night.

The brand recently announced it has formed a partnership with the Aston Martin Aramco Formula One Team for the 2026 season, with the aim of providing drivers and team members with tools designed to optimize recovery through better sleep quality.

Eight Sleep's Pod will be used to address the physical and cognitive demands of a long, high-pressure racing schedule, with the Eight Sleep logo appearing on the nose of the car, driver balaclavas, cooling vests, and handheld cooling fans in the garage.
